Mariners Suffer Stinging Defeat in ALCS Game 4
The Seattle Mariners faced a devastating setback in Game 4 of the American League Championship Series, as the Toronto Blue Jays surged to a commanding 13-4 victory at T-Mobile Park. This loss not only dampened the Mariners’ hopes but also showcased the Blue Jays’ formidable offensive arsenal.
